When weighing your decision on which balance is best for your classroom, knowing the goal of the lesson will provide your answer.  What capacity and readability will fit your students’ needs?  Capacity is the maximum mass a balance can measure. Readability is the smallest difference in mass that will be displayed on the balance.  If students are comparing objects, a two-pan balance is the best option.  But if precise measurement is the focus of your lesson, then an electronic balance will provide the most accurate reading.
